  • Siberian Larch, known for its durability and aesthetic appeal, is imported as kiln-dried lumber for Larch decking, directly kiln-dried and planed to achieve a moisture content of 12-15%. This ensures high product stability and a smooth surface texture after planing, making it an excellent choice for decking. Custom-made Siberian Larch decking products undergo processing, drying, and planing, with the drying time meticulously estimated based on the moisture content of the raw logs. This process guarantees the decking's longevity and beauty but requires longer preparation time. Without proper drying, the planed surface of the Larch decking may become rough or fuzzy, underscoring the importance of this step in the production process.

    Originating mainly from Eastern Siberia, Northeastern Mongolia, Northeastern China, and Korea, Siberian Larch stands out for its straight trunk with few knots, showcasing a clear distinction between heartwood and sapwood. The wood, tough, slightly coarse, and featuring a straight grain, is imbued with natural oils and a distinctive pine resin aroma. These properties confer resistance to corrosion, pests, and weathering, making Larch decking a robust option for outdoor use. It is also easy to process, further enhancing its appeal for decking applications. In addition to its high density and strength, Siberian Larch decking is prized for its natural knots and the distinct patterns of spring and autumn wood grain, adding character and warmth to any space.

    Ideal for a variety of applications, including indoor and outdoor flooring, fencing, decks, pergolas, and home wall panels, Siberian Larch decking offers a combination of durability, natural beauty, and versatility, making it a preferred choice for architects, builders, and homeowners alike.
